This page is for expressing my opinion on various aspects of being a pituitary patient.Although I am far from being a medical expert on the subject, I have been a patient for over 25 years. During this time I have been on hormone replacement therapy, which has taken me from a young child, through puberty, into adulthood and married life. I have also had (and still do!) a successful career as a computer programmer. And all achieved without a pituitary gland. So I believe I can offer a unique insight into the ups and downs of coping with such an illness.
